As you know, the emc-pstc listserver is operated
by volunteers, two of whom manage the daily work
of subscribing, unusubscribing, and otherwise
maintaining the integrity of our address list.
We're once again looking for a volunteer who can
help us with this job. The job requires daily
review of and response to messages sent by majordomo,
the IEEE listserver application. These messages are
comprised of subscribe requests, unsubscribe
requests, message delivery problem reports,
message bounces, and non-member posting attempts.
We don't need a computer guru, but if you happen
to understand both your own mail system and the
internet mail system, this would be a benefit.
Sometimes, we have to do some sleuthing to deal
with a problem. We do need someone who doesn't
have a message limit to their mail system.
The admin duties require daily (weekday) attention.
We have two such admins that share the work. One
does all of the work when the other cannot.
